"Sleeping Giant" by Alex, 17 | Isle Royale National Park
This land form is called sleeping giant. It kind of looks like a giant lying down to rest. I like it because it is an amazing view from the top of the highest peak on Isle Royale. I was also glad to capture its beauty at a time when the clouds were so interesting. I think it is a great photo.
About Alex: "My name is Alex. I am 17 years old and live in Chicago. Recently I have made some poor choices which resulted in my placement in Northwest Passage Lakeshore. But I have planned to change my lifestyle. Here I have discovered that I have an interest in nature photography and that I can use it to extend my passion for nature."
